"Shakhtar" Donetsk does not hide ambitions to step into the Champions League semi-finals, but Ukrainians will have to present a big surprise - in the quarterfinals they will face the powerful "Barcelona". "Barcelona" - Donetsk "Shakhtar" "Camp Nou" Stadium, Barcelona 21:45 Lithuania time Referee: Craig Thomson (Scotland) Broadcast: Viasat Sport Baltic (live) "Shakhtar's" season is going well - the club convincingly leads the Ukrainian championship and is 12 points ahead of their fiercest rival Kiev's "Dynamo", and in the Champions League Group H they left London's "Arsenal" behind with 15 points. However, in the English capital, the Donetsk team lost 1-5, and a similar scenario repeating in Catalonia would mean the end of the season in Europe even before the second leg. In the round of 16, the Ukrainian team eliminated "Roma" with a total score of 6-2 and has not lost at their stadium yet, so the main task in the first leg will be to hold on and hope to determine the fate of the ticket to the semi-finals on April 12 in Donetsk. "Barcelona" coach Pep Guardiola has already admitted that the fact that the second leg will take place away is not convenient, but the Spanish champions remain the clear favorites of the tie. However, there are other concerns: on Wednesday, two key defenders - Carles Puyol and Eric Abidal - will not be able to take to the field, and Lionel Messi played only 38 minutes in the last match and did not train at all on Monday. Meanwhile, "Shakhtar" hopes that last year's Barcelona's midfielder Dimitro Chygrynskyi will return to the lineup. Interestingly, in December 2008, the Donetsk club has already celebrated a victory at "Camp Nou" - back then, the visitors won 3-2. However, the last meeting - a match for the European Super Cup - eight months later in Monaco ended with a 1-0 victory for "Barcelona".
